Mr. Gable presented Solicitation No. 25-161A; Netzsch Pump Parts for Sod Run Wastewater Treatment Plant; Competitive Sealed Bid. Mr. Phillip Gable from the Department of Public Works is requesting approval for the purchase of Netzsch pump parts to be used at the Sod Run Wastewater Treatment Plant. Netzsch pumps are a necessity for moving wastewater through the treatment process. Netzsch aftermarket and OEM parts are essential to maintain pump functionality as wear from continuous operation can lead to failures. Without readily available parts, pump downtime could disrupt treatment processes, risking untreated wastewater discharge, environmental violations, public health hazards, and substantial daily fines from the Maryland Department of the Environment. The Department of Public Works recommends award in the amount not to exceed $300,000.00 per year to ACCA Industrial LLC of Katy, Texas, Liberty Processing Equipment of Arlington Heights, llinois, and Pyrz Water Supply, Incorporated of Harleysville, Pennsylvania in accordance with Section 41-25 of the Harford County Code. Mr. Hebel presented Solicitation No. 20-108; Woodley Road Extension Design; Change Order # 6. 1 Mr. Glen Hebel from the Department of Public Works stated that this proposal is for the engineering and design services necessary for extending Woodley Road from its current terminus across Aberdeen Proving Ground property to MD715. The work is required by Abeerdeen Proving Ground prior to their site approval for the road extension and the utility infrastructure relocation. The Department of Public Works requests approval for Change Order # 6 in the amount not to exceed $384,904.12, increasing the contract not to exceed total to $1,674,507.97 to Rummel, Klepper & Kahl, LLP of Baltimore, Maryland in accordance with Section 41-25 of the Harford County Code.
